Transaction 66f396742e559fabebc39aca552691047a4a89ba0e1f0ffda2b3e338883b4c80

1 Input
2 Outputs
  • 66f396742e559fabebc39aca552691047a4a89ba0e1f0ffda2b3e338883b4c80:0
  • value  1563924
    address  32uWt5CXZRJ5Za1dCgk6p3Ae2Ny8Mx3aYj
  • 66f396742e559fabebc39aca552691047a4a89ba0e1f0ffda2b3e338883b4c80:1
  • value  1446511
    address  1AFi74gd5RnBz9ffpoG1C2sK6Y5JP3YGN2